On 10/4/18 1:17 PM, Christophe Fergeau wrote:
> This should only be included from c files.
> 
> Signed-off-by: Christophe Fergeau <cfergeau@xxxxxxxxxx>
> ---
>  common/client_marshallers.h | 4 ----
>  common/mem.h                | 4 ----
>  common/messages.h           | 4 ----
>  3 files changed, 12 deletions(-)
> 
> diff --git a/common/client_marshallers.h b/common/client_marshallers.h
> index 919e889..912494b 100644
> --- a/common/client_marshallers.h
> +++ b/common/client_marshallers.h
> @@ -19,10 +19,6 @@
>  #ifndef _H_MARSHALLERS
>  #define _H_MARSHALLERS
>  
> -#ifdef HAVE_CONFIG_H
> -# include "config.h"
> -#endif
> -
>  #include <spice/protocol.h>
>  
>  #include "common/generated_client_marshallers.h"
> diff --git a/common/mem.h b/common/mem.h
> index 1c7cfa3..68e024a 100644
> --- a/common/mem.h
> +++ b/common/mem.h
> @@ -23,10 +23,6 @@
>  #include <stdlib.h>
>  #include <spice/macros.h>
>  
> -#ifdef HAVE_CONFIG_H
> -# include <config.h>
> -#endif
> -
>  SPICE_BEGIN_DECLS
>  
>  #ifdef STDC_HEADERS
> diff --git a/common/messages.h b/common/messages.h
> index 55de76e..14d5c64 100644
> --- a/common/messages.h
> +++ b/common/messages.h
> @@ -31,10 +31,6 @@
>  #ifndef _H_MESSAGES
>  #define _H_MESSAGES
>  
> -#ifdef HAVE_CONFIG_H
> -#include "config.h"
> -#endif
> -
>  #include <spice/protocol.h>
>  #include <spice/macros.h>
>
